cockamamie, cockamamy
(adjective) informal term for ridiculous and implausible; “he gave me a cockamamie reason for not going”
Source: WordNet® 3.1
cockamamie (plural cockamamies)
(US, chiefly, dated) A decal, a design that can be transferred to a surface.
A foolish or ridiculous person.
cockamamie (comparative more cockamamie, superlative most cockamamie)
Foolish, ill-considered, silly, unbelievable.
Trifling.
• (foolish, unbelievable): goofy, sappy, unreasonable, wacky, zany
